Question
The value of (2x2 + 4) ÷ 2 is ______.
Options
2x2 + 2
x2 + 2
x2 + 4
2x2 + 4
Advertisements
Solution
The value of (2x2 + 4) ÷ 2 is x2 + 2.
Explanation:
We have,
`(2x^2 + 4) ÷ 2 = (2x^2 + 4)/2`
= `(2(x^2 + 2))/2` ...[Taking 2 as common]
= x2 + 2
